The paper studies the effect of laser shock peening on the physical and mechanical properties of the surface layer of D16 aluminum alloy. Experiments were carried out with different values of laser radiation intensity. The dependences of maximum deformations and microhardness on the intensity of radiation are obtained. The effect of the value of the laser radiation energy at a fixed intensity on the size of the area of metal plastic deformation is investigated.
